Double glazing lets you keep your home cool in summer and warm in winter.
Utilizing double glazing to keep the house cool in summer and warm winter is a smart way to improve the value of your home and improve the energy efficiency of your home. efficient. Double glazing can save you up to 25% off your energy bills. You might not even realize it that your home is losing about half of its heat through windows as well as doors and windowsills.
Double glazing is a great method to keep heat inside and heat out. When your windows are double-glazed and you have the ability to keep your home cool without having to run an air conditioner.
Double glazing is more durable than single-glazed glass, which means it won't need to be replaced. In fact, it's expected to last at least 20 years.
Double-glazed windows are an effective method to stop the sound from entering your home. This is especially important in the winter months when neighbors and family members want to catch up on sleep.
One method to double glaze a window is to put an optical grade acrylic panel within the frame. This will not just seal the window, but it will also let in lots of natural light.
A reflective e-coating can be used to reduce the loss of heat from double-glazed windows. This is a way to reflect heat back to its source, keeping your home at an optimum temperature.
Double-glazed windows are excellent because they help keep your home warmer during winter and cooler during summer. This is due to the spacer bars and other insulation materials make an airtight seal.
Cleaning a window made of upvc
UPVC windows are a great choice for homeowners looking for durable windows that are easy to maintain. These windows are made of Poly Vinyl Chloride, which is rotproof and energy efficient. However, there are some common problems with these windows. They could need to be repaired or replaced.
Cracks, leaky seals or discoloration are among the issues uPVC windows can suffer from. These issues can be corrected easily and can save you the expense of hiring a technician. Based on the issue, you may need to replace the glass seals, hinges and seals or window restrictors.
You should be sure to clean uPVC windows regularly. Regular cleaning can stop rust from developing, and can help prevent other problems. It is recommended to check the drain holes of your windows frequently. You can clean uPVC windows using an easy cloth and water or soap.
For more stubborn stains, you can try a diluted bleach solution. You may also employ a professional for this job, since the abrasive cleaning products can harm your windows.
If you have a uPVC window with a crack You may want to use a solvent PVC cleaner. These are available at your local hardware shop. However, you must be aware not to use the solvent on silicone seals. Also, be careful to remove the cement buildup.
